India's Interreligious Unions
Interfaith relationships in India present a unique blend of legal and social challenges. While the Indian Constitution guarantees the freedom of decision in matters of wedlock, societal traditions often pose significant barriers. Families and communities may disapprove of such partnerships based on religious variations, leading to potential friction. Legally,unions recognized by law are governed by personal laws that vary depending on the religions involved, sometimes complicating the process. However, increasing social acceptance and legal amendments are paving the way for a more inclusive environment that embraces diverse forms of love and attachment.
